Visiting contractors may use the quiet room on the top floor of Thorncliff House for calls and focused work only. No meetings, no food, phones on silent. The room is unbookable; first come, first served. Leave it as found. Contractors must sign in at reception before heading up. The door is keypad-locked; enter with the code below.

door code, yahif-yagag: bdg-FKXEAK-64235764

## Further Reading

Inkpress is Durnley's PDF invoice renderer. It consumes billing events from the Larkspur queue and produces signed PDFs stored in the archive tier. Templates are versioned; never edit a live template, as historical invoices must re-render identically. Locale handling, tax-line formatting, and the template release process each have their own docs. Start with the architecture overview, then the template guide. All of these, plus the local development setup instructions, are collected on the internal page below.

operations page: https://jira.qorvelsys.internal/browse/pages/browse/pages

Subject: Key rotation for InvoiceForge renderer

Welcome, new folks. Every quarter we rotate the credential the Pellworth PDF invoice renderer uses to call our internal asset service, Vaultline. The old key stops working Friday at noon. Update your local .env and the staging config before then, and verify a test invoice renders with the new embedded fonts. For convenience, the freshly issued key is included here.

app token of bagef-bageg = kto11_vuwA0uhrEMg

Ticket PRNT-88: Drift detected on the Quillfeed spooler microservice. Welcome aboard — this is a good first issue. Two of the three staging replicas are running values that diverge from the committed manifest, likely from a manual hotfix last quarter that was never merged back. Please reconcile the replicas against the intended state. The canonical configuration the service should be running is shown below.

settings of fajop-fahap:
[holeth]
port = 9300
team = juleth
host = holeth.tolvaqsoft.example
region = south-4
access_code = ac_4bcdf6
timeout_ms = 500

### Step 4 — Ship the receipt mailer

Once GiftPigeon's donation-receipt mailer passes the smoke test, push the build to the Larkfield edge nodes. Don't skip the dry-run — it catches template mismatches that otherwise page you at 2 a.m. The deploy script will prompt you to sign the bundle, so paste in the key below.

deploy key for kajof-fajop: bky6_gDHw9Q